PROCEDURE

实验过程

To a round bottomed flask was added (S)-1-chloro-4-(3-methylpiperazin-1-yl)pyrido[3,4-d]pyridazine 4 (155 mg, 588 μmol), 4-trifluoromethylphenylboronic acid (167 mg, 882 μmol), tetrakis(triphenylphosphine)palladium (34 mg, 29 μmol), and 2 M aqueous sodium carbonate (588 μl, 1.18 mmol). Toluene (5.9 mL) was added and the reaction was heated to 100° C. After 16 h, the reaction was cooled to RT and diluted with ethyl acetate (70 mL). The organic layer was washed with 1×10 mL of sat. NaHCO3, 1×10 mL of brine. The organic layer was dried over MgSO4, filtered, and concentrated. Purification by column chromatography (10:0.5:0.1) (CH2Cl2:MeOH:Et3N) afforded (S)-4-(3-methylpiperazin-1-yl)-1-(4-(trifluoromethyl)phenyl)pyrido[3,4-d]pyridazine 47 (154 mg, 70% yield). 1H-NMR (400 MHz, CDCl3): δ 9.55 (d, J=0.8 Hz, 1H), 8.90 (d, J=5.5 Hz, 1H), 7.86 (m, 4H), 7.73 (dd, J=5.5, 0.8 Hz, 1H), 4.09 (m, 2H), 3.37 (ddd, J=12.5, 11.0, 3.5 Hz, 1H), 2.23 (m, 3H), 2.99 (dd, J=12.5, 10.2 Hz, 1H), 2.85 (br s, 1H), 1.17 (d, J=6.3 Hz, 1H). MS 373.1 (calc'd) 374.0 (M+H, found).
